Loading...

카테고리 없음 / / 2023. 11. 8. 11:23

ora-01643 시스템 테이블 공간를 읽기 전용으로 만들 수 없습니다.

설명

ORA-01643 오류는 사용자가 시스템 테이블스페이스를 읽기 전용으로 설정하려고 할 때 발생합니다. 시스템 테이블스페이스는 오라클 데이터베이스의 핵심 요소로, 데이터베이스의 운영에 필수적인 객체와 스키마 정보를 포함하고 있습니다. 이러한 테이블스페이스는 데이터베이스가 실행 중일 때 항상 쓰기 가능 상태여야 합니다.

원인

오라클 데이터베이스는 시스템 테이블스페이스가 항상 쓰기 가능한 상태로 유지되어야 하므로, 시스템 테이블스페이스를 읽기 전용으로 설정하는 것은 허용되지 않습니다. 이것은 데이터베이스의 정상적인 운영을 방해할 수 있기 때문입니다.

에러가 발생하는 예시

ALTER TABLESPACE SYSTEM READ ONLY;

위 명령은 시스템 테이블스페이스를 읽기 전용으로 설정하려고 시도합니다. 이 명령은 ORA-01643 오류를 발생시킬 것입니다.

해결방법

시스템 테이블스페이스를 읽기 전용으로 만들려는 시도를 중단하십시오. 이 테이블스페이스는 쓰기 가능한 상태로 유지되어야 합니다.

주의사항

다음 사항에 유의해야 합니다:

  • 데이터베이스 관리 시스템(DBMS)의 기본 설정을 변경하기 전에는 항상 해당 변경이 허용되는지 여부를 확인해야 합니다.
  • 시스템 테이블스페이스에 대한 변경을 시도하기 전에, 데이터베이스의 중요한 정보를 백업하는 것이 좋습니다.